The Back Door Weakness (And How Bifolds Overcome It)

Traditionally, the rear of a property was the easiest point of attack. Older French doors and sliding doors could be forced open with crowbars or lifted off tracks. But modern bifolds have raised the bar dramatically:

  1. Multi-Point Locking Systems
    • Each folding leaf locks at multiple points into the track and adjoining panels. This means no single panel can be forced independently.
    • With up to five points of locking per panel, a full set of bifolds can have dozens of locking points.
  2. Shoot Bolts
    • Top and bottom shoot bolts engage into the head and sill tracks, anchoring each panel like a deadbolt.
  3. Aluminium Strength
    • Aluminium frames are lightweight for smooth sliding, but inherently stronger than timber or uPVC. They resist twisting and prying.
  4. Toughened or Laminated Glass
    • Every pane can be specified with glass that resists impact and shattering. Laminated glass stays intact even when cracked, buying time and drawing attention.
  5. Anti-Lift Tracks
    • Just like sliding doors, modern bifolds include anti-lift features that stop panels being levered out of the frame.

Certification That Matters

It’s one thing for a door to feel secure. It’s another for it to be tested and proven. GFD’s bifold systems are available to meet:

  • PAS 24 standards – rigorous testing against attack methods.
  • Secured by Design accreditation – the official police-backed standard for crime prevention.

This isn’t marketing fluff. These accreditations mean doors have literally been attacked in labs with crowbars, drills and hammers – and passed.

Everyday Security Tips for Bifold Owners

Even the best-engineered bifolds rely on you, the homeowner, to use them properly. Here are three quick tips:

  • Always lock them, even when home. Around 24% of burglars enter through unlocked doors. Don’t make it easy.
  • Use blinds or curtains at night. Preventing opportunistic window-shopping of your valuables is half the battle.
  • Combine with lighting or CCTV. A wide glass opening is far less inviting if the space is well-lit and monitored.
